Sue and Ben discuss the Government's recent big announcements on drugs, crime and plans for congestion charging.Sue and Ben discuss the Government's recent big announcements on drugs, crime and plans for congestion charging.New Zealand First has invoked its 'agree to disagree' provision - how did it go down?The latest poll shows stable support for the coalition, but what about the 'preferred Prime Minister' stakes?And how is Labour's rebuilding strategy going?Sue Moroney is a former MP with the Labour Party and now chief executive of Community Law Centres Aotearoa.Ben Thomas is a former National government press secretary, a columnist and a director of public affairs firm Capital.Go to this episode on rnz.co.nz for more details
